Location

The Radnorshire Arms Hotel is situated in Presteigne, just yards from the English border and surrounded by rolling hills and open countryside. This Grade II listed building combines historical charm with a convenient location in Radnorshire Township. Visitors can explore the local area, rich in cultural and historical landmarks.

Dining

The hotel's large timber-framed bar and restaurant serves a menu filled with heart pub classics, appealing to a wide range of tastes. Visitors can enjoy a delightful Sunday roast dinner made throughout the year. An inviting beer garden allows guests to unwind during long summer evenings.
